This experiment adopts design for cracked section,sets up different treatments on small sheds and seedling ages,conducts data analysis on in-room temperature,soil temperature and humidity,etc.climatic factors,and compares the influences exerted by different sheds on growth,yield,tolerance to immature bolting of spring Chinese cabbage.The results indicates that plastic shed has remarkable effect in raising its inner day air temperature,but no distinct effect in maintaining its inner night air temperature.Compared with single layer plastic shed,double-layer one has better effect in maintaining its inner air humidity,but in respect of raising or maintaining air temperature,its effect is not distinct.Compared with no water-sack one,the double-layer plastic shed with black sack full of water can promote the day air temperature rising and slow the night air temperature decreasing.Plastic shed has significant effects in promoting the growth of spring Chinese cabbage and increasing its yield.Besides it can also inhibit the extension of main flower stalk in heads.In this experiment,the growth,yield and tolerance to immature bolting of spring Chinese cabbage under the treatment with single-layer shed without water sack are relatively better than the other treatments.
